Richmond, KY to Paducah, KY is 281.2 miles and takes about 5h 17m via Western Kentucky Parkway and I-69, with a fuel budget near $44 and enough daylight to finish in a day. This drive is a straightforward, highway-focused journey across Kentucky, connecting the Southeast region of the state to its western parts. With an 88% highway share, you'll spend most of your time on efficient, faster-paced roads. It’s a solid option for a single day of driving, allowing you to cover a significant distance without feeling overly rushed. Consider this route if you prioritize getting from point A to point B efficiently.

This route is predominantly a highway-focused drive, with 88% of it utilizing major roadways. You'll experience long, uninterrupted stretches, including one that lasts for 98.9 miles on the Western Kentucky Parkway. Expect a consistent pace for much of the journey, making it feel like a direct path across the state. While the majority is high-speed travel, keep an eye out for the transition onto I-69 as you near your destination. The character is largely about covering ground efficiently.
This is a straightforward highway drive that stays mostly on Western Kentucky Parkway and Bluegrass Parkway. This route has several spots where lane changes, forks, or exits need your full attention. The trickiest moment comes around 16.2 miles in.

Given the 5h 17m estimated drive time, starting your trip in Richmond, KY, after breakfast is ideal for reaching Paducah, KY, with plenty of daylight to spare. The drive is manageable in one day, so you have the flexibility to make spontaneous stops if needed. With a fuel cost estimated at $44, be sure to check your fuel levels before departing and plan a refueling stop, as the longest stretch without a significant change in road type is nearly 99 miles. While there's only one indicated stop, consider a brief pause around the halfway mark to stretch your legs and stay refreshed.
